Job description

The Installer is an essential part of Green Power Energy's Field Operations team. As an Installer, each employee works with the latest solar technology, builds relationships with team members, and completes the installation of our products safely and on time. Green Power Energy's ideal candidate will have a passion for learning basic energy system construction, terminology, and concepts. This position is an hourly role that requires working outside in extreme environments, working at heights, and prolonged periods of repetitious duties including lifting, bending, and standing for long periods.

Responsibilities
  1. Load job components for the project.
  2. Assembly of solar modules/array and mounting hardware.
  3. Mechanical/structural mounting of racking, modules, and electrical equipment.
  4. Attend training sessions on new products, installation methodology, and safety.
  5. Assist Lead Installers on daily projects.
  6. Unload and carry materials at construction sites.
Qualifications
  1. Able to work in a team.
  2. Able to read instructions.
  3. Very good knowledge of English (spoken and written).
  4. Excellent balance and eye-hand coordination.
  5. High school diploma or equivalent.
  6. Construction experience is a plus.
  7. Electrical experience is a plus.
